Overview

I am an illustrator and owner of grumpy chihuahuas based in the southwest of the UK. I have been working in the industry for the last 14 years and have collaborated with a variety of publishers on both fiction and non-fiction projects. I specialize in traditional illustration techniques, including pen and ink and printmaking, which I was inspired to pursue after discovering some of my grandfather's old materials. My preferred subjects are nature, folklore, supernatural and historical narratives.

Work experience

Self-employed

Sep, 2010 — Present

I am an experienced illustrator freelancing in the field for the past 14 years. During this time, I have worked with many clients to create diverse outcomes, including packaging, advertising, editorial, and book illustration. I have experience working with both traditional and digital mediums and am proficient in using Adobe Suite. I enjoy collaborating with others on design concepts and can work independently.
